This is a 1/25 scale 1938 Chevrolet Krispy Kreme panel delivery truck that was made by Ertl. I got some years ago at, of all places, a Krispy Kreme donut store !

This one also doubles as a coin bank with key, although a figure of Homer Simpson is not included. However, if you obtain this truck for your collection you will undoubtedly have an intense desire for delicious donuts ..... Roll
